Transaction 6687c0f43f35fc81b9f1c65565061707386fa6bca5b5790cd91000101804e691
2 Input
2 Outputs
- 6687c0f43f35fc81b9f1c65565061707386fa6bca5b5790cd91000101804e691:0
- 6687c0f43f35fc81b9f1c65565061707386fa6bca5b5790cd91000101804e691:1
value 1392368
address 16eRME2fysWH89ZUWxmjjNwYxRtJcS5vqv
value 3374925
address 3Ft1NJKWUNPrZTPXh8ykLxeoLKxtfyn194